Acclaimed as the best book ever written on St. Thomas, this
outstanding profile introduces one of Christianity's most important
and influential thinkers. G. K. Chesterton chronicles the saint's
life, focusing on the man and the events that shaped him, rather
than on theology. In a concise, witty, and eminently readable
narrative, he illustrates the relevance of St. Thomas' achievements
to modern readers.
Born into an aristocratic family, Thomas rejected a life of
privilege to join a new order of preaching and teaching monks, the
Dominicans. Chesterton compares Thomas' views to those of another
famous thirteenth-century figure, St. Francis of Assisi. He also
explores the influence of Aristotelian philosophy on Thomas'
character, along with the effects of Parisian culture, society, and
politics. The final chapter examines the impact of Thomas' work on
later religious thinkers, including Martin Luther. This brief but
vivid profile provides fascinating glimpses into the medieval
scholastic movement, and it presents an excellent beginning to
further explorations of St. Thomas Aquinas' works.
